After reading this, it might be a good idea for you to go to a bike shop and get fitted on your bike. Unless your Dad is a professional, it's likely your bike is not fitted properly. This can cause a whole host of problems... more than just a sore butt.
This was already mentioned... but are you wearing bike shorts with GOOD padding in them? Don't skimp on the shorts... they help with keeping your rear comfy.
